Job Overview:
We are seeking a proactive and organised School Administrator to contribute to the smooth operation of our client's esteemed educational institution.
As a key member of the administrative team, you will play a vital role in supporting various functions and ensuring a seamless educational experience for students, parents, and staff.
Responsibilities:
- Administrative Support: Provide comprehensive administrative support to the school, including managing inquiries, maintaining records, and facilitating efficient office operations.
- Enrolment Management: Oversee the student enrolment process, handling admissions, registrations, and maintaining accurate and uptodate student records.
- Communication Hub: Act as a central point of contact for communication within the school community, fostering positive relationships with parents, faculty, and staff.
- Financial Administration: Assist in budget management, ensuring compliance with financial policies and tracking expenses.
- Human Resources Assistance: Collaborate with the HR department to support personnelrelated tasks, including onboarding, attendance tracking, and maintaining employee records.
Qualifications:
- Proven experience in school administration or a similar role.
- Strong organisational and multitasking skills.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and other relevant software like SIMS is preferable
